Dubai Sunset Golden Hour Glow: Best Viewing Spots
Choosing the right location fundamentally alters the experience, whether you seek the bustling energy of a public space or the exclusive serenity of a luxury hotel terrace. Venue Type Experience Best For Rooftop Lounge 360-degree city views, sophisticated cocktails Adults seeking nightlife and photography Beachfront Restaurant Sound of waves, casual dining options Families and couples wanting a relaxed vibe.
JBR (Jumeirah Beach Residence):strong>: The long, lively boardwalk here is perfect for a casual evening stroll, with the sun dipping behind the high-rise buildings as the evening cool sets in. Safari Tours: Many tour operators schedule dune bashing or camel treks to coincide with sunset, allowing travelers to witness the sky change colors while seated on the crest of a sand dune.
